Five aspects in GTA 5 that were improved upon from GTA San Andreas
5) Animals

Animals were in most of the 3D GTA games, but they're largely just background objects that the player couldn't interact with. GTA San Andreas was no different in this regard, even if they started to give animals a little more focus.
However, GTA 5 made animals significantly more important. Not only were they slightly more relevant to in-game missions, but the player was able to interact with them. There were dogs, cats, deer, and several other animals that the player could see in GTA 5.
There was even a hunting feature in GTA 5, which made use of some of the animals in the countryside.
4) The countryside
GTA San Andreas introduced a massive countryside to the series, and it had the largest map until GTA 5 came out. However, one thing some GTA San Andreas players might notice about the countryside is that there aren't too many activities to do there.
As mentioned previously, the wildlife and hunting features from GTA 5 made the countryside feel more alive. Combine this with a larger map overall, and it's easy to see GTA 5's rural areas as being more intractable.
Plus, GTA 5's better graphics make its countryside more aesthetically pleasing.

1) Sports

GTA San Andreas was the first major GTA game to allow players the ability to partake in various sports. There were triathlons, pool, and basketball, but they were rather primitive when compared to what GTA 5 had.
GTA 5 had triathlons, but there was also golf, tennis, arm wrestling, and darts. Basketball is a fun sport, but all CJ could do was a few tricks and shoot some hoops by himself.
By comparison, GTA 5's golf and tennis felt similar to a full-fledged experience. Due to this, they were more fun to do for longer periods of time compared to the sports in GTA San Andreas.
